![]() A sphere’s great circle (also orthodrome) is the greatest circle that may be made on any sphere. The Haversine formula calculates the great-circle distance between latitude and longitude locations on a sphere, which may be used to estimate distance on Earth (since it is mostly spherical). In the Haversine formula, d is the distance between two locations on a great circle, r is the sphere’s radius, ϕ1and ϕ2are the two points’ latitudes, and λ1 and λ2are the two points’ longitudes, all in radians.
